Pet Cougar on Leash Bites Louisiana Child
Associated Press
SHREVEPORT, La. —
A woman’s pet cougar lunged at two girls in a parking lot, biting one before a bystander pushed the cat away.
The owner drove off with the cougar in a pickup truck after the incident, leaving the parents of the injured 7-year-old wondering if the cat is free of rabies.
One bite broke the skin on the child’s chest, but the wound did not appear to be serious. The cougar was on a long leash at the time.
